Understanding the Domain Lifecycle

A domain name goes through several stages from registration to expiration. Understanding this lifecycle helps prevent accidental loss of a domain.

Active Domain

  • Domain is registered and active
  • Website and email function normally
  • Renewal date is visible in the client area

Expiration

  • Occurs if the domain is not renewed on time
  • Website and email may stop working
  • Domain enters a grace period

Grace Period

  • Typically lasts a few days to weeks
  • Domain can still be renewed
  • Additional fees may apply

Redemption Period

  • Domain is no longer easily recoverable
  • Higher restoration fees apply
  • Not guaranteed to succeed

Pending Deletion

  • Domain is scheduled for deletion
  • Cannot be renewed or recovered
  • Becomes available for public registration

Keeping auto-renew enabled is strongly recommended.
